The All Black Peak is a 2025  m high mountain that belongs to the Bowers Mountains in northern Victoria Land. It rises there as the highest point of the Crown Hills at the southeast end of the Lanterman Range on the eastern flank of the Johnstone Glacier .

The New Zealand Antarctic Place-Names Committee named it in 1983 at the suggestion of the geologist Malcom Gordon Laird (1935-2015) after its black rock.
